unity提高開發(fā)效率
第一段:簡介 在游戲開發(fā)領(lǐng)域,Unity是一款備受開發(fā)者歡迎的游戲引擎。它提供了強(qiáng)大的功能和工具,能夠幫助開發(fā)者快速創(chuàng)建高質(zhì)量的游戲。然而,隨著項(xiàng)目的增長和復(fù)雜性的提升,開發(fā)效率成為了很多團(tuán)隊(duì)面
第一段:簡介
在游戲開發(fā)領(lǐng)域,Unity是一款備受開發(fā)者歡迎的游戲引擎。它提供了強(qiáng)大的功能和工具,能夠幫助開發(fā)者快速創(chuàng)建高質(zhì)量的游戲。然而,隨著項(xiàng)目的增長和復(fù)雜性的提升,開發(fā)效率成為了很多團(tuán)隊(duì)面臨的挑戰(zhàn)。本文將分享一些利用Unity的技巧和方法,來提高開發(fā)效率。
第二段:利用插件和資產(chǎn)商店
Unity的插件和資產(chǎn)商店是開發(fā)者提高開發(fā)效率的絕佳資源。通過使用這些插件和資產(chǎn),我們可以快速獲得各種功能和工具,減少重復(fù)勞動。例如,有一款強(qiáng)大的UI插件讓我們可以快速創(chuàng)建和管理用戶界面,省去手動編寫和調(diào)整的步驟。還有一些優(yōu)秀的特效和材質(zhì)包,能夠讓我們在游戲中加入高質(zhì)量的視覺效果,提升用戶體驗(yàn)。
第三段:使用Unity的腳本系統(tǒng)
Unity的腳本系統(tǒng)是我們提高開發(fā)效率的利器。通過編寫自定義的腳本,我們能夠自動化許多繁瑣的操作和重復(fù)的任務(wù)。比如,我們可以編寫一個腳本來自動生成游戲關(guān)卡的地形,減少手動布置的工作量。另外,Unity的腳本系統(tǒng)還支持批量處理,可以快速對大量資源進(jìn)行操作,提高開發(fā)效率。
第四段:合理使用預(yù)制體
Unity的預(yù)制體是一種非常強(qiáng)大的工具,可以幫助我們快速創(chuàng)建和復(fù)用游戲?qū)ο?。通過將一組相關(guān)的對象打包成預(yù)制體,我們可以在項(xiàng)目中多次使用,節(jié)省大量時(shí)間。比如,我們可以創(chuàng)建一個敵人的預(yù)制體,然后在游戲中多次復(fù)制和調(diào)整,快速生成不同類型的敵人。合理使用預(yù)制體可以極大地提高開發(fā)效率。
第五段:利用Unity的調(diào)試工具
Unity提供了豐富的調(diào)試工具,可以幫助我們快速排查和解決問題。通過合理利用這些工具,我們可以更快地定位并修復(fù)bug,提高開發(fā)效率。例如,Unity的調(diào)試模式能夠顯示游戲?qū)ο蟮膶傩院蜖顟B(tài),方便我們進(jìn)行實(shí)時(shí)調(diào)試。另外,Unity還提供了強(qiáng)大的Profiler工具,幫助我們分析游戲性能瓶頸,優(yōu)化代碼。
結(jié)尾段:總結(jié)
通過插件和資產(chǎn)商店、腳本系統(tǒng)、合理使用預(yù)制體和利用調(diào)試工具等方法,我們可以大幅提高Unity開發(fā)的效率。希望本文對正在使用或考慮使用Unity進(jìn)行游戲開發(fā)的開發(fā)者們有所幫助。